INSTALLATION OF LOWER ARM
1. CONNECT LOWER ARM TO BALL JOINT
lnstall the lower arm to the ball joint with a nut.
Torque the nut and install a new cotter pin.
Torque: 800 kg-cm (58 ft-lb, 78 N'm)
2. INSTALL SPACER, RETAINER, CUSHION AND
COLLAR
3. CONNECT LOWER ARM TO BODY
(d Pass the lower arm through the stabilizer bar.
(b) Connect the lower arm with the bolt. Do not torque
the bolt yet.
(c) lnstall the stabilizer bar with the cushion, washer and
a new nut. Do not torque the nut Yet.
4. CONNECT LOWER ARM TO STEERING KNUCKLE
(a) Lower the stabalizer bar and connect the balljoint to
steering knuckle with the two nuts.

(b) Torque the nuts.
Torque: 820 kg-cm (59 ft-lb, 8O N.ml
5. INSTALL TIRE AND LOWER VEHICLE
Bounce the vehicle to stabilize the suspension.
6. TOROUE NUT HOLDING STABILIZER BAR TO
LOWER ARM ,#i{:Torque: 1,O75 kg-cm (78 ft-lb, lOb N.m)
!:rt !'
7. TOROUE BOLT HOLDING LOWER ARM TO BODY
Torque: 1,150 kg-cm (83 ft-tb, 113 N.ml
8. CHECK FRONT WHEEL ALIGNMENT (See pase FA-31

INSTALLATION OF STABILIZER BAR
1. INSTALL STABILIZER BAR END TO LOWER ARM
(d lnstall the spacer, retainer, rubber and collar as
shown in the figure.
(b) Finger tighten a new stabilizer bar nut.
2. INSTALL BRACKET TOGETHER WITH STABILIZER
BAR
Pry the bar forward and install the brackets.
Torque the bolts.
Torque: rt4o kg-cm (32 ft-lb,43 N.ml
3. TOROUE NUT HOLDING STABILIZER BAR TO LOWER
ARM
Torque: 1,O75 kg-cm (78 ft-lb, 105 N.ml
NOTE: Bounce the vehicle to stabilize the suspension
before torquing the stabilizer bar nut.
4. INSTALL ENGINE UNDER COVER
5. CHECK FRONT WHEEL ALIGNMENT (See page FA-3)

5. PACK BEARINGS WITH MP GREASE
(a) Place MP grease in the palm of your hand.
(b) Pack grease into the bearing, continuing until the
grease oozes out from the other side.
(c) Do the same around the bearing circumference.
6. INSTALL INNER BEARING AND NEW OIL SEAL
(a) Place the inner bearing into the axle hub.
(b) Using SST, drive a new oil seal in the axle hub.
ssT 09608-2001 1
(c) Apply MP grease to the oil seal.
INSTALLATION OF REAR AXLE HUB AND
CARRIER
(See page RA-51
1. INSTALL AXLE CARRIER
(a) Place the axle carrier in position.
(b) Install the two bolts and nuts holding the axle carrier
to the shock absorber. Torque the nuts.
Torque: 1,450 kg-cm (105 ft-lb, 142 N.m)
(c) Provisionally install the bolt and nut holding the axle
carrier to the No.2 suspension arm.
NOTE: Be sure the lip of the nut is resting on the flange
of the suspension arm-not over it.
(d) Provisionally install the bolt and nut holding the axle
carrier to the No.l suspension arm.
NOTE: When installing, insert the lip of the nut into the
hole on the suspension arm.

(e) Provisionally install the bolt and nut holding the axle
carrier to the strut rod.
NOTE: When installing, insert the lip of the nut into the
groove on the bracket.
2. INSTALL AXLE SHAFT
lnstall the axle shaft and rear brake assembly with four
bolts. Torque the bolts.
Torque: 820 kg-cm (59 ft-lb, 80 N'ml
3. CONNECT BRAKE TUBE TO WHEEL CYLINDER
ssr 09751 -3601 1
Torque: 155 kg-cm (11 ft-lb. 15 N.m)
4. INSTALL AXLE HUB ON SPINDLE
(a) Place the axle hub and outer bearing on the axle
shaft.
(b) Fill in MP grease between the outer bearing and
thrust washer.
(d lnstall the thrust washer.
5. ADJUST PRELOAD
(a) Install and torque the nut.
Torque: 300 kg-cm {22 tt-\b,29 N'ml
